During the 17th century, present day Illinois was part of the French colony of New France. The Diocese of Quebec, which had jurisdiction over the colony, sent numerous French missionaries to the region. After the British took control of New France in 1763, the Archdiocese of Quebec retained jurisdiction in the Illinois area. In 1776, the new United States claimed sovereignty over the area of Illinois. WebIn 1908, the Diocese of Rockford was formed from the Chicago Archdiocese. Barrington, where the jointly-financed rectory was located, was in the Chicago Archdiocese, while Crystal Lake, of course, was part of the Rockford Diocese. An arrangement was made whereby the Diocese of Rockford was allowed jurisdiction in the Barrington section of the ...
